Oil and gas leases in Diamondback Operating, LP
Diamondback Operating, LP is a Texas operator, Commission number 217024, with 31 leases reporting production across 2 counties. Between them they carry 31 wellbores. Reported volumes run from March 2004 to March 2020 and come to 5.2 million Mcf of gas.
